Day 03 LAUTERBRUNNEN VALLEY - MT. JUNGFRAU - INTERLAKEN

After breakfast, proceed to the breathtaking Lauterbrunnen Valley, renowned as the deepest U-shaped valley in the world, with towering cliffs rising nearly 1,000 meters on either side. Continue your journey by boarding a cogwheel train to the summit of Mt. Jungfrau, situated at an altitude of 3,454 meters above sea level. At the top, enjoy free time to explore the magical Ice Palace, featuring intricate life-sized ice sculptures, and visit the Sphinx Observation Deck, which offers spectacular panoramic views of the Aletsch Glacier and surrounding Alpine peaks. After this unforgettable mountain experience, descend and proceed to Interlaken, a charming town nestled between lakes and mountains. Enjoy a leisurely walk along the main street, soak in the serene surroundings, and admire the stunning Swiss scenery. Overnight Stay Interlaken, Switzerland.

Day 10 ROME - FLORENCE - PISA

Depart from Rome and travel to the magnificent city of Florence, the cradle of the Renaissance. On arrival, you will be welcomed by a local professional guide for a city tour. Explore the Duomo of Florence, the largest brick dome ever constructed, and take photo stops at the Basilica of Santa Croce, the final resting place of Michelangelo, and the replica of the statue of David. Stroll across the iconic Ponte Vecchio Bridge spanning the Arno River, and visit Piazelle Michelangelo, offering the most outstanding panoramic views of the city. As coaches are restricted in parts of Florence, most of the tour is conducted on foot, allowing you to fully appreciate the historic architecture and vibrant streets. In the afternoon, depart for Pisa. Upon arrival, marvel at The Piazza del Duomo (Cathedral Square), home to four magnificent religious structures: the Duomo, the Leaning Tower of Pisa, the Baptistery, and the Camposanto Monumentale. Enjoy some free time here to capture photographs or shop for souvenirs. Overnight Stay Pisa, Italy.

FAQs

Do Indian citizens need a visa to visit Italy?
Yes. Indian passport holders generally need a Schengen short-stay visa (Type C) for tourism. A short-stay Schengen visa generally permits stays of up to 90 days within the applicable 180-day period.
What is the best time to visit Italy?
April–June and September–October are popular for comfortable sightseeing. Summer is good for coastal destinations but can be hot and busy. Winter is attractive for Christmas markets, skiing and fewer crowds in many cities. Italy offers different experiences throughout the year. 
How many days are enough for an Italy tour?
5–7 days: Rome + Florence/Venice 8–10 days: Rome + Florence + Venice 12–15 days: Add Milan, Pisa, Naples/Amalfi Coast or other destinations
What are the must-visit places in Italy?
Rome, Vatican City, Florence, Venice, Milan, Pisa, Naples, Amalfi Coast, Lake Como and Cinque Terre are among the most popular choices.
Is vegetarian Indian food available in Italy?
Yes. Indian restaurants and vegetarian options are available in major tourist cities. For Jain, vegan or other specific dietary requirements, it is advisable to research restaurants in advance.
What currency is used in Italy?
The official currency is the Euro (€). Major cards such as Visa and Mastercard are widely accepted, although some cash can be useful. 
What should I pack for Italy?
Comfortable walking shoes are essential. Also pack layers, weather-appropriate clothing, a light jacket/rain protection and modest clothing if you plan to visit churches and religious sites.
Is travel insurance required for an Italy Schengen visa?
Travel insurance is part of the documentation requirements for a Schengen tourist visa. Check the latest official checklist for the exact coverage requirements applicable to your application. 
What type of hotels are available in Italy?
Italy offers everything from budget hotels and B&Bs to 3-star, 4-star and luxury 5-star hotels. 
What is the time difference between India and Italy?
Italy uses CET (UTC+1) during standard time and CEST (UTC+2) during daylight-saving time. The difference from India therefore changes during the year.
